Coefficient of Determination

A statistical measure represented as \(R^2\) that shows the proportion of variance for a dependent variable explained by an independent variable or variables in a regression model.

Simple Linear Model

A statistical model used to describe the relationship between two variables through a linear equation.

Quadratic Model

A mathematical model that involves an equation of the second degree, typically representing a parabolic relationship between variables.
